生成优胜美地或Mavericks安装USB闪存驱动器的最佳方法是什么?[重复]


17

我可能可以从软件包中复制内容,但是为Mavericks创建安装闪存驱动器的最佳方法是什么?

当然,理想情况下,驱动器应该是可引导的。


为了加强本指南下方的某些答案,可能会提供帮助arstechnica.com/apple/2013/10/…–
西蒙(Simon)

Answers:


22

编辑:这也应适用于具有6.33GB +分区的El Capitan


当前最好的方法似乎是通过createinstallmedia,这也是Apple推荐的方法

首先Mac OS Extended (Journaled)在USB闪存盘上创建5GB或更大的分区:

8GB分区,名为MavericksInstall

然后在终端中使用createinstallmedia命令。它可以在Maverick安装apk中找到。默认情况下,路径为/Applications/Install OS X Mavericks.app/Contents/Resources/createinstallmedia

/Volumes/MavericksInstall用您自己的分区名称替换:

sudo /Applications/Install\ OS\ X\ Mavericks.app/Contents/Resources/createinstallmedia --volume /Volumes/MavericksInstall --applicationpath /Applications/Install\ OS\ X\ Mavericks.app --nointeraction

输出应遵循以下几行:

Copying installer files to disk...
Copy complete.
Making disk bootable...
Copying boot files...
Copy complete.
Done.

根据您的USB驱动器,安装过程可能需要几分钟到几十分钟。


要为多个OS X版本创建USB安装程序,可以执行以下过程:

  • 启动磁盘实用程序
  • 创建格式为的多个分区Mac OS Extended (Journaled)。给他们起这样的名字:
    • OS X Lion: LionInstall
    • OS X Mountain Lion: MountainLionInstall
    • OS X小牛: MavericksInstall

  • 使用createinstallmedia每个OX 10.9+版本的工具生成多个安装分区,并使用disktool添加其他安装分区:
    • 将InstallESD.dmg从还原/Applications/Install Mac OS X Lion/Contents/SharedSupport/Volumes/LionInstall
    • 将InstallESD.dmg从还原/Applications/Install OS X Mountain Lion/Contents/SharedSupport/Volumes/MountainLionInstall
    • sudo /Applications/Install\ OS\ X\ Mavericks.app/Contents/Resources/createinstallmedia --volume /Volumes/MavericksInstall --applicationpath /Applications/Install\ OS\ X\ Mavericks.app --nointeraction

根据经验,这里是每个OS X版本的数据使用情况:

  • OSX 10.6雪豹:7.19GB
  • OSX 10.7 Lion:4.78GB(需要6.13 GB)
  • OSX 10.8山狮:4.48GB
  • OSX 10.9小牛:5.4GB
  • OSX 10.10优胜美地:5.25GB
  • OSX 10.11 El Capitan:6.33GB
  • macOS Sierra:4.84GB

这是一个很好的答案。
艾迪·凯利

@EddieKelley:是的,我10分钟前才开始安装。该驱动器是可引导的,到目前为止一切正常。我喜欢它作为一个班轮:)
郊狼

由于它会擦除磁盘,因此有必要创建分区吗?在使用磁盘之前,我已经按照您的指示擦除了磁盘,因此无法测试。
Abhi Beckert

是的,您必须提供一个有效的现有分区的路径。除此之外,我不确定是否createinstallmedia只是复制文件并使分区可启动,还是在此之前擦除分区。
郊狼

如果您使用同一驱动器进行存储,以禁用自动挂载该卷,这可能会有所帮助apple.stackexchange.com/questions/24539/…–
diimdeep

4

假设您已将USB闪存驱动器插入名称为“ Untitled”的计算机,则我创建可引导Mavericks安装磁盘的首选方法可能是:

hdiutil mount "/Applications/Install OS X Mavericks.app/Contents/SharedSupport/InstallESD.dmg"

sudo asr restore --source "/Volumes/OS X Install ESD/BaseSystem.dmg" --target /Volumes/Untitled --erase

sudo unlink "/Volumes/OS X Base System/System/Installation/Packages"

sudo cp -Rp "/Volumes/OS X Install ESD/Packages" "/Volumes/OS X Base System/System/Installation"

为什么用这种方式而不是通过Disk Utility.app还原它?
ⱮarkƬ

1
我不喜欢使用鼠标。
Eddie Kelley 2013年

我查看了DMG文件,看起来该分区不再可引导,因此我不确定此方法是否可以使可引导安装程序生效。
ⱮarkƬ

可引导映像(BaseSystem.dmg)是“包装”磁盘映像(InstallESD.dmg)内部的不可见文件,但是BaseSystem.dmg内部的Packages文件夹只是指向外部磁盘映像(鸡和鸡蛋)的链接。 。使用BaseSystem.dmg对驱动器进行映像,取消链接,然后将程序包复制到/ System / Library / Installation / Packages中,将产生可引导的10.9安装程序。
艾迪·凯利

1
是的,安装程序将在您安装的驱动器上放置一个Recovery HD分区。注意:此可启动USB驱动器实质上是恢复分区。
艾迪·凯利

4

绝对最简单的方法(请相信我)是下载此应用程序LionDiskMaker ,它将完成每个人都说过的一切,只有它会自动完成

(可以随意捐款(我不是应用程序的创建者,但是效果很好))

直接下载链接!


1
由于现在称为DiskMakerX。
西蒙(Simon)

我倾向于不同意这是绝对最简单的方法。为什么?简而言之,因为每个OSX安装程序一个USB记忆棒。如果每个USB记忆棒要安装多个OSX安装程序,则必须使用其他方法。(apple.stackexchange.com/questions/188398/...
esaruoho

2

从这个要点创建可启动的OS X Mavericks USB安装程序

  • 首先,插入8GB(或更大)的USB驱动器,然后使用“磁盘工具”将其擦除
  • 如果使用默认设置,则应在处插入空白驱动器/Volumes/Untitled

放置好该卷并放置Mavericks安装程序后/Applications/Install\ OS\ X\ Mavericks.app,在终端中运行以下命令以创建可引导安装媒体:

sh sudo /Applications/Install\ OS\ X\ Mavericks.app/Contents/Resources/createinstallmedia --volume /Volumes/Untitled --applicationpath /Applications/Install\ OS\ X\ Mavericks.app --nointeraction

您应该看到类似以下的输出-可能需要一段时间才能完成。

Erasing Disk: 0%... 10%... 20%...100%...
Copying installer files to disk...
Copy complete.
Making disk bootable...
Copying boot files...
Copy complete.
Done.

要从安装程序引导,请重新引导Mac并按住alt/ option键,然后它将选择从USB磁盘引导。


这是IMO最好的方法,但看来您实际上已经说出了与此答案相同的东西:apple.stackexchange.com/a/106112/21050
zigg 2013年

0

只需将安装程序复制到闪存驱动器。挂载闪存驱动器后,您只需双击即可安装。如果将其从闪存驱动器移至启动驱动器上的/ Applications文件夹,它将安装得更快。完成后还应该清理安装程序。


好吧,这种工作方式很好,但是如果您需要从头开始安装或重新安装到新驱动器上则不需要。然后需要可引导的闪存驱动器。
郊狼
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.